###php下&&和and有什么区别 php中的逻辑“与”有两种形式:and 和 &&,同样的“或”运算也有or 和 ||两种形式 如果单独两个表达式参与的运算,两种形式的结果完全相同,例如: $a and $b 和 $a && $b没有任何区别。同样的$a or $b 和$a || $b 也完全一样。 但是两种形式的逻辑运算符优先级不同,这四个符号的优先级从高到低是:&& || and or 。特别注意,这句话要仔细理解。举例: $a || $b and $c || $d 相当于 ($a || $b) and ($c || $d)